Q: The tile cache on Mapperly keeps serving stale tiles — what gives? A: Welcome aboard! The Glazeworks cache layer holds tiles for 24h; invalidation runs on style pushes only. If you need to purge manually, use the admin console, which requires unsealing first. The recovery passphrase you'll need is right below.

vault phrase of tajop-haduf = holath-brivan-wenax

Finance Review Summary — Bramhollow Retail Pilot

To: Heads of Department

The eight-store pilot with the Bramhollow chain closed Q3 slightly above breakeven. Setup costs ran 9% over plan; weekly sell-through improved steadily from week five. Returns rate acceptable. A decision on expansion is pending and relates to the note that follows.

board note of kageg-bahof: The renewal with Holwynax Holdings closes at $2 million a year, 5 percent below the last contract. Project Ulaath slips by two quarters because of the supplier delay.

**Cron drift — who to contact**

Scope: the ongoing Tallow scheduler drift investigation affecting nightly jobs on the Morvane cluster. Owner: Scheduling Infra. Do not hold releases unless drift exceeds 15 minutes. Status updates post every morning to the infra channel. Questions about release impact or timing exceptions go to the investigation lead directly.

escalation mailbox, yajeg-bageg: quenax.olidor@lumiccorp.internal

Ticket: Missed pick-up – sealed-bid tender package

Priority: High

The courier from Vannel Express did not arrive for yesterday's 16:00 collection of the sealed-bid tender for the Croftdale bridge works. The package remains in the locked cabinet at the dispatch desk, seal intact. Submission deadline at the Croftdale procurement office is Friday noon, so a replacement pick-up has been booked for tomorrow at 09:00. Do not release the envelope to anyone outside the booked run. The confidential instruction for the courier hand-over follows below.

handover note for yagef-bagep: the drudor pelius courier leaves the kasdor zorvan norir ledger at gate 8016 under passcode 755406

Subject: DR drill Thursday — canary gating reminder

New folks: during the Orvetta drill, canary deploys to Pelicanline services gate on error rate <0.5% and p99 latency within 10% of baseline for 15 minutes. No manual overrides during the drill. If the canary fails, rollback is automatic. To rejoin the drill control channel after rollback, use the recovery passphrase below.

unlock words, yadup-yagef: zorael-druix